Our federal government client is seeking a Technical Writer to support the development of military concepts and documentation. The role includes researching, writing, editing, and producing content aligned with future capability development and operational needs.

Tasks

  • Research and write concept, design, and discussion papers on military and capability development topics

  • Gather, analyze, and synthesize technical and operational information for target audiences

  • Produce accurate, clear, and concise documentation that meets organizational standards

  • Create final camera-ready copy using word-processing, desktop publishing, and graphics tools

  • Review and revise documents to ensure compliance with style, formatting, and content standards

  • Modify and validate content, ensuring clarity and consistency in technical language

  • Deliver briefings to communicate updates, terminology changes, and conceptual developments

  • Collaborate with subject matter experts and project stakeholders to refine written materials

  • Support editing and verification processes for translated or adapted documents

  • Maintain version control and participate in regular reporting of writing activities and progress

Qualifications

  • Post-secondary degree or diploma in any field from a recognized Canadian academic institution

  • At least two (2) years of experience contributing to military policy, doctrine, or concept documents

  • Strong ability to draft and edit technical and conceptual materials in a clear and structured manner

  • Familiarity with military language, operational structures, and document development processes

  • Skilled in using Microsoft Office and desktop publishing tools for professional document production

  • Experience in briefing and communicating complex technical content to varied audiences

  • Capable of remote work with occasional in-person collaboration as required

  • Reliability level of security clearance
